This blast of a book represents children’s non-fiction at its finest. It’s packed with inspirational interstellar facts about the first moon landing, all delivered in a well-considered, scrapbook-style design that enhances the subject matter, from the retro typewriter font, to the easy-on-the-eye information boxes. Covering everything from why the moon mission happened in the first place, to astronaut training, lift-off preparation, life on board, exploring the moon, and much more, the book’s USP is its emphasis on how it felt to be in Neil, Buzz and Michael’s moon boots. It provides answers to questions all space-obsessed kids will devour: how did the astronauts get to the moon? How did they go to the toilet? What did they eat? What were their space suits like? What work did they have to do on board? How did they actually land? With an inspiring introduction by Helen Sharman, the first Briton to travel to space, this is perfect for fact-loving young readers to launch into, and should be on the shelf of every school library.

Kids love collecting and what could be bigger and better than collecting mountains? The Wainwrights Pocket Log and Tick List is a handsome little book, small enough to pop into a pocket and take up into the Lakeland fells. Conveniently grouped in accordance with the famous Wainwright Pictorial Guides, the pocket log has a dedicated page for each of the 214 Wainwright Fells and kids will love to record details of their walks and keep a tally of their achievements. With a velvet-like cover and gilded pages it has a quality feel and would be a welcome addition to any young walker's Christmas stocking.

One of a series of unusual first concept books, this board book introduces children to colours using objects from the British Museum’s collection. Each one of the dozens of items featured is beautiful to look at, from the green porcelain bowl (China 18th century), to the gold Roman coin (AD 125) to Grayson Perry’s yellow Rosetta Vase (2011). They clearly have stories to tell too and more information is available by scanning a QR code featured at the back of the book. Child-focused and useful the book successfully introduces not just colours but a first sense of history and the dynamic ever-changing cultures and civilisations of our world. ~ Andrea Reece

This delightful new book for children takes the reader on a colourful trip through the history of painting with Picasso as guide. It reproduces some of Picasso's most famous works alongside the paintings that inspired them, fromVelazquez's Meninas to Manet's notorious Dejeuner sur l'Herbe, exploring why Picasso loved them so much and how he re-created them in his own inimitable style. The book ends with an activity section in which children can use their own pencils and brushes to distort, reshape and paint what they feel - just like Picasso!
